Acupoint stimulation device using focused ultrasound
N Tsuruoka1, M Watanabe, T Seki
1Graduate School of Biomedical Engineering, Tohoku University, Sendai, Japan. a6tb1177@cs.he.tohoku.ac.jp
Abstract:
Acupuncture is used widely in oriental medicine. But it is difficult to stimulate continuously or intermittently in daily life with conventional acupuncture. An acupoint stimulation device using focused ultrasound has been developed. Because the device size is about 6 mm in diameter, it can be easily put on the skin during daily life. Appropriate stimulation intensity and pattern can be chosen by changing driving voltage and pattern. In this paper, we stimulated acupoints with this device and measured the blood flow volume of brachial artery. As a result, the blood flow volume increased significantly as well as acupuncture. Because the device stimulate acupoints with intactness of skin, advantages of this device is free from infection and fear and pain by insertion of acupuncture needles.
